Memorials of the Late Mrs. Barber, of Longford Academy, Near Gloucester is a book written by William Barber in 1822. The book is a tribute to his late wife, who was a teacher at Longford Academy. The book contains a collection of letters, poems, and other writings that were written by Mrs. Barber during her time at the academy. The book also includes a biography of Mrs. Barber, detailing her life and accomplishments. The book is a touching tribute to a beloved wife and teacher, and provides a glimpse into the life of a woman who was dedicated to education and the betterment of her students.This scarce antiquarian book is a facsimile reprint of the old original and may contain some imperfections such as library marks and notations.
